Given:
4 3/4 pounds of clay
1 1/10 pounds of clay for a cup
2 pounds of clay for a jar
Convert the mixed fraction into fractions.
4 3/4 = (4*4+3)/4 = 19/4
1 1/10 = (1*10+1)/10 = 11/10
2 = 2/1
19/4 - 11/10 = (19/4 *5/5) - (11/10 * 2/2) = 95/20 - 22/20
= (95-22)/20 = 73/20 or 3.65 pounds after making a cup
73/20 - 2/1 = 73/20 - (2/1 * 20/20) = 73/20 - 40/20 = 73 - 40 / 20 = 33/20 OR 1.65 pounds left after making a jar.
We can also convert the fractions into decimal numbers.
19/4 = 4.75
11/10 = 1.10
2/1 = 2.00
4.75 - 1.1 - 2 = 1.65 pounds left.
